How they compare
Philippines currently reports 71.0% against 69.0% in Togo, a difference of 2.0%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 6 shared years of data; in 2019 it was Philippines ahead.
Philippines ranks 136th and Togo ranks 139th of 179 countries.
Philippines has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Philippines | Togo |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 67.0% | 59.0% | 8.0% | Philippines |
| 2020s | 65.4% | 63.2% | 2.2% | Philippines |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
